Skip to content

Commit 3d37e19

Browse files
committed
Fixes to fields provider
1 parent 42621ee commit 3d37e19

File tree

2 files changed

+4
-8
lines changed

2 files changed

+4
-8
lines changed

sumologic/provider.go

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-64,6 +64,7 @@ func Provider() terraform.ResourceProvider {
6464
"sumologic_monitor": resourceSumologicMonitorsLibraryMonitor(),
6565
"sumologic_monitor_folder": resourceSumologicMonitorsLibraryFolder(),
6666
"sumologic_ingest_budget_v2": resourceSumologicIngestBudgetV2(),
67+
"sumologic_field": resourceSumologicField(),
6768
},
6869
DataSourcesMap: map[string]*schema.Resource{
6970
"sumologic_caller_identity": dataSourceSumologicCallerIdentity(),

sumologic/resource_sumologic_field.go

Lines changed: 3 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,6 @@ func resourceSumologicField() *schema.Resource {
1010
return &schema.Resource{
1111
Create: resourceSumologicFieldCreate,
1212
Read: resourceSumologicFieldRead,
13-
Update: resourceSumologicFieldUpdate,
1413
Delete: resourceSumologicFieldDelete,
1514
Importer: &schema.ResourceImporter{
1615
State: resourceSumologicFieldImport,
@@ -21,7 +20,7 @@ func resourceSumologicField() *schema.Resource {
2120
"field_name": {
2221
Type: schema.TypeString,
2322
Required: true,
24-
ForceNew: false,
23+
ForceNew: true,
2524
},
2625

2726
"field_id": {
@@ -33,13 +32,13 @@ func resourceSumologicField() *schema.Resource {
3332
"data_type": {
3433
Type: schema.TypeString,
3534
Required: true,
36-
ForceNew: false,
35+
ForceNew: true,
3736
},
3837

3938
"state": {
4039
Type: schema.TypeString,
4140
Required: true,
42-
ForceNew: false,
41+
ForceNew: true,
4342
},
4443
},
4544
}
@@ -93,10 +92,6 @@ func resourceSumologicFieldDelete(d *schema.ResourceData, meta interface{}) erro
9392
return c.DeleteField(id)
9493
}
9594

96-
func resourceSumologicFieldUpdate(d *schema.ResourceData, meta interface{}) error {
97-
return nil
98-
}
99-
10095
func resourceSumologicFieldCreate(d *schema.ResourceData, meta interface{}) error {
10196
c := meta.(*Client)
10297

0 commit comments

Comments
 (0)